00900170-01_ID_OIS_SIS_16.0_R18-2_EN_DE - 第136页
ASM OIS/SIS Daten banken 16.0 (R18- 2) / Schnitts tellenbeschreibung Ausgabe 11/2018 62 Der OIS Server generi ert die folgende n Einträge für je de Leiterplatte: Tabelle EVENT ● Neues Event: PC B_BEGIN , wenn die Produk …

ASM OIS/SIS Datenbanken 16.0 (R18-2) / Schnittstellenbeschreibung Ausgabe 11/2018
61
7.6 "Quad Lane"-Unterstützung
Die Stationssoftware ab Version 702 unterstützt den Transportmodus "Quad Lane", bei dem vier
Leiterplatten parallel gefertigt werden. Dazu besitzt jede Transportspur zwei Untertransportspuren.
In jeder dieser Untertransportspuren können Leiterplatten in die Bestückbereiche transportiert
werden, wobei die Untertransportspuren einer Transportspur immer im synchronen Modus
arbeiten, also die Leiterplatten beider Untertransportspuren gleichzeitig bestückt werden.
Abbildung 7-2: Quad Lane
Die Information, auf welcher Untertransportspur eine Leiterplatte transportiert wurde, wird in der
Spalte lSubConveyor in der BOARD-Tabelle der OIS-Datenbank abgelegt.
Wenn eine Station nicht im Transportmodus "Quad Lane" arbeitet, so beträgt der Wert dieser
Spalte immer "0". Wenn die Station im Transportmodus "Quad Lane" arbeitet, bedeutet der Wert
"1", dass die Leiterplatte in der rechten Untertransportspur gefertigt wurde und der Wert "2", dass
die Leiterplatte in der linken Untertransportspur gefertigt wurde.
Angewandt auf das obige Beispiel ergibt sich daraus folgende Tabelle:
strBoard
ucConveyor
lSubConveyor
lBoardNumber
PCB2L
2
2
20
PCB2R
2
1
21
PCB1L
1
2
22
PCB1R
1
1
23
HINWEIS
Bitte beachten Sie, dass jede Leiterplatte eine eigene "Board-ID" (lBoardNumber)
bekommt. Die Werte in der Spalte lBoardNumber sind nur Beispiele. Auch kann daraus
nicht die Reihenfolge der Nummerierung abgeleitet werden, sondern das Beispiel soll
lediglich zeigen, dass jede Leiterplatte eine individuelle " lBoardNumber" bekommt.
Das Verhalten ist gleich im synchronen und asynchronen Modus.
ASM OIS/SIS Datenbanken 16.0 (R18-2) / Schnittstellenbeschreibung Ausgabe 11/2018
62
Der OIS Server generiert die folgenden Einträge für jede Leiterplatte:
Tabelle EVENT
● Neues Event: PCB_BEGIN, wenn die Produktion gestartet wurde.
● Neues Event: PCB_END, wenn die Produktion beendet wurde.
Tabelle BOARD
● Für jede gefertigte Leiterplatte wird eine Zeile in die Tabelle BOARD eingetragen.
Tabelle USEDCOMPONENTS
● Für jedes bestückte Bauelement wird eine Zeile in die Tabelle USEDCOMPONENT
eingetragen.
Im Transportmodus "Quad Lane" werden diese Datenbankeinträge für jede einzelne Leiterplatte
durchgeführt.

ASM OIS/SIS Datenbanken 16.0 (R18-2) / Schnittstellenbeschreibung Ausgabe 11/2018
63
8 Anhang
8.1 Zeitanteile
Im Folgenden wird die Konfiguration der Zeitanteile beschrieben. Ein Zeitanteil ist eine
Zusammenfassung von Zuständen eines Bestückautomaten. Ein Zustand kann von 0 % bis 100 %
einem Zeitanteil zugeordnet werden. Die Zeitanteile können vom Kunden frei definiert werden.
Als ASM Standard wird nachfolgende Einstellung (Tabelle) bereitgestellt. Diese Tabelle entspricht
der Zuordnung von Zuständen zu Zeitanteilen im MaDaMaS.
MaDaMaS Zeitanteile:
T
1
= Laufend
T
2
= Wartend
T
3
= Blockiert
T
4
= Unterbrochen
T
5
= Störung
T
6
– T
8
= nicht verwendet
Verfügbarkeit Zeitanteile:
T
a
= technische Verfügbarkeit, Herstellerverantwortung
T
b
= Belegungszeit (Einschaltdauer)
Angezeigter Zustand:
T
9
= Anzeigen des Zustands in der Tabelle der Ansicht "Zustände"
0 = nicht anzeigen
1 = anzeigen
Nr.
Zustand
Beschreibung
T
1
T
2
T
3
T
4
T
5
T
a
T
b
T
9
1
OIS_PCB_BEGIN ||
OIS_PCB_BEGIN2
Beginn Produktion Leiterplatte
100
0
0
0
0
100
100
0
2
OIS_PCB_END ||
OIS_PCB_END2
Ende Produktion Leiterplatte
0
100
0
0
0
100
100
0
3
OIS_BREAK_BEGIN
Abbruch; die Produktion wurde unterbrochen
0
0
0
100
0
100
100
0
4
OIS_EMERGENCY_STOP
Die Notaus-Taste wurde gedrückt
0
0
0
100
0
100
100
1
5
OIS_AIR
Die Druckluftversorgung ist ausgefallen
0
0
0
0
100
100
100
1
6
OIS_STOP
Die Halt-Taste wurde gedrückt
0
0
0
100
0
100
100
0
9
OIS_WAIT_PCB_IN
Warten auf Leiterplatte im Eingabeband
0
100
0
0
0
100
100
0
10
OIS_WAIT_PCB_INSIDE
Warten auf Leiterplatte im Mittenband
100
0
0
0
0
100
100
0
11
OIS_WAIT_PCB_OUT
Warten, bis Ausgabeband frei ist
0
0
100
0
0
100
100
0
12
OIS_WAIT_DATA
Warte, bis Daten gesendet worden sind
0
100
0
0
0
100
100
0
14
OIS_FIDUCIAL_ERROR
Eine Marke wurde nicht erkannt
0
0
0
0
100
100
100
0
15
OIS_TRACK_ERROR
Spur leer
0
0
0
0
100
100
100
0
16
OIS_MACHINE_ERROR
Fataler Maschinenfehler aufgetreten
0
0
0
0
100
0
100
1
17
OIS_TRANSPORT_ERROR
Fataler Transportfehler aufgetreten
0
0
0
0
100
100
100
0
18
OIS_BARCODE_ERROR
Fataler Barcodefehler aufgetreten
0
0
0
0
100
100
100
0
20
OIS_HEAD_STEP
Taktbetrieb aktiv
0
0
0
100
0
100
100
1
21
OIS_KEY_SLOW
Schlüsselschalter auf langsam
0
0
0
100
0
100
100
1